Output 8cf60c78d13fbfe75d8283ef4b9a7b042f56a60e26abddd1b0fb9a14e13469d2:4

value
349189814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62d0d9540f59192f810a00b60d42ba96b6b76be7 OP_EQUAL
address
MGueeJqB4bfAcSf6oQjNfw3W8xreQJakcw
transaction
8cf60c78d13fbfe75d8283ef4b9a7b042f56a60e26abddd1b0fb9a14e13469d2
spent
true